Buhari Swears In Arase As PSC Chairman
President Muhammadu Buhari has sworn in Solomon Arase as the chairperson of the Police Service Commission (PSC).
Arase, a former inspector-general of police, was sworn in on Wednesday.
He took his oath of office at the council chamber of the presidential villa during the federal executive council meeting.
Vice-president Yemi Osinbajo, Boss Mustapha, secretary to the government of the federation; Ibrahim Gambari, chief of staff to the president, and other FEC members were present at the swearing in ceremony.
The senate had in January confirmed Arase as the head of PSC.
The 65-year-old retired from the Nigeria Police Force (NPF) in 2016 after serving as the 18th IGP.
